EEPROM

EEPROM is an IC (Integrated Circuit) chip that stores information or data. It is a non-volatile memory that keeps its stored information even when the power is off. It is a modern version of EPROM which was first created in 1978. It makes use of electricity to erase its content instead of UV rays. It is reprogrammable indefinitely. It can be used as a chip for storing configurations, parameters, or calibration coefficients.

Modern cars require a specific chip to communicate with the car in order to start. If this chip isn't set up correctly, the car won't turn on. This is why the majority of people call locksmiths when they want to program the car's key. The process is generally more simple than you'd think. It is simply a matter of following the steps as they are described in the manual for your vehicle or by searching online for "onboard programming steps for X car."

Onboard key programming is a straightforward method that doesn't require a sophisticated car key programming. It involves a few simple steps that put the car into "learn mode," which allows you to program additional FOBs, or a spare key. However this method isn't supported by all cars and could be limited in its application by the car's computer. It's not as fast as EEPROM or OBD2 programs.

Car key programming is a process that your vehicle will need to go through to get an entirely new remote, fob, or key. It is a complicated process that requires specialized equipment as well as the ability to perform it. It can be difficult to accomplish this when you don't have the right tools and experience. You should seek professional help. This will ensure that the work is done correctly and in a timely manner, minimizing the risk of damage to your car or key.

Modern cars usually require a transponder chip that is programmed to the car. The key isn't able to start the vehicle without this programming. This can be done at the locksmith shop or by using an instrument designed to program car keys. The device must be plugged into the car's OBD2 connector and then send the code to the chip. The chip will then alter the code to ensure it matches the car's OBD2 system.

Certain older vehicles might not have this feature and may require a traditional blade style key that is placed into the ignition cylinder. A lot of auto shops can program these keys, even although they are more difficult to program. They will charge a higher price, but are more likely to have the proper equipment.

The EEPROM method is a different key programming method. It is utilized in the latest vehicles, including BMW and Mercedes. This is a complicated process that requires soldering, circuit boards and programming skills. This is a complex procedure that should only be performed by professionals. If the wrong method is used, it could cause data corruption on the module. This could cause the vehicle to stop working or cause other problems.
